According to a recent LinkedIn post from Classiq, the company is using the Milano Cortina 2026 Olympic slalom event to illustrate how quantum physics underpins real-world performance. The post draws parallels between high-speed skiing and the quantum mechanical behavior of materials like steel edges and carbon fiber in skis.

The company’s LinkedIn post highlights that concepts such as crystalline symmetry, electron behavior in lattices, and quantum decoherence can explain the structural integrity athletes rely on under extreme stress. By framing quantum mechanics through a sports narrative, the post suggests an effort to make complex technology more accessible to a broader, non-technical audience.
For investors, this type of content may indicate a strategic emphasis on thought leadership and brand positioning rather than a specific product or commercial milestone. The focus on education and storytelling around quantum concepts could help Classiq build mindshare in the emerging quantum computing ecosystem, potentially supporting future business development and partnership opportunities.
However, the post does not reference customer wins, funding developments, new offerings, or measurable adoption metrics. As a result, the immediate financial implications appear limited, and the content may be better interpreted as long-term brand-building that could indirectly support Classiq’s competitive positioning in quantum software and tools over time.
